The firmware update channel for Lantersk devices is failing CI on the signing stage. The signer container pulled a newer base image overnight and dropped the legacy digest algorithm our bootloaders expect. Pin the signer image until the bootloader fleet is migrated. Verification against a bench device passes with the pinned build referenced below.

session token of kageg-tahop = htk14_af3c1ccccb7dcf

Action item: The Relayn deploy-status bot silently dropped updates when the pipeline API paginated results, so responders believed a rollback had completed when it had not. We will add pagination handling, a staleness banner, and an integration test. Until merged, verify deploy state directly in the pipeline console, documented at the page below.

runbook for kahop-kajop: https://rundeck.ordinio.test/display/secrets/pipeline/issue/pages/repo/browse/e5732776e07d1285107e5aeb

Step 3: Configure the deduplication pass

Before cutting over to Ledgermere's unified customer table, the deduplication job must run against the legacy records. Verify that the staging snapshot is current and that the merge-review queue is empty, as pending reviews will block auto-merges. This step is irreversible once merges commit, so confirm thresholds with the data owners first. Apply the following job configuration.

settings of fajop-fahap:
[holeth]
port = 9300
team = juleth
host = holeth.tolvaqsoft.example
region = south-4
access_code = ac_4bcdf6
timeout_ms = 500